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$109.63 | 4.153% | $114.1829 | $114.18 | $114.20 | $114.20 |
Purchase #2 | $206.25 | 5.118% | $216.8059 | $216.81 | $216.80 | $216.80 |
Purchase #3 | $250.29 | 5.452% | $263.9358 | $263.94 | $263.95 | $263.90 |
Purchase #4 | $123.63 | 4.814% | $129.5815 | $129.58 | $129.60 | $129.60 |
Purchase #5 | $92.85 | 3.229% | $95.8481 | $95.85 | $95.85 | $95.80 |
Purchase #6 | $164.90 | 10.498% | $182.2112 | $182.21 | $182.20 | $182.20 |
Purchase #7 | $54.36 | 9.607% | $59.5824 | $59.58 | $59.60 | $59.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,001.91 | $1,062.1478 | $1,062.15 | $1,062.20 | $1,062.10 |
